Website Credibility Concerns:

Several analyses have raised concerns about the legitimacy of The Lost Generator's website:

  • Domain Information: The domain owner’s information is hidden in the WHOIS database, which can be a red flag.
  • New Domain: The website is relatively new, having been registered on November 6, 2024. New domains can sometimes be associated with scams, as they lack a proven track record.
  • Low Trust Scores: Websites like ScamDoc have assigned The Lost Generator a very low trust score of 3%, indicating potential risks.
  • Server Associations: The website shares its server with several unreliable sites, which may negatively impact its credibility.
